asp 语言 ASP 语言代码调试的高效技巧

ASP阿木 发布于 28 天前 3 次阅读


ASP 语言代码调试的高效技巧

ASP(Active Server Pages)是一种服务器端脚本环境,用于创建动态交互式网页和Web应用程序。在开发过程中,代码调试是必不可少的环节,它可以帮助开发者快速定位并修复错误。本文将围绕ASP语言代码调试的高效技巧展开讨论,旨在帮助开发者提高调试效率,提升开发质量。

一、了解ASP代码调试的基本概念

1. 错误类型

ASP代码中的错误主要分为两大类:语法错误和逻辑错误。

- 语法错误:由于代码编写不规范导致的错误,如拼写错误、缺少分号等。

- 逻辑错误:代码逻辑不正确导致的错误,如变量未定义、条件判断错误等。

2. 调试工具

ASP代码调试主要依赖于以下工具:

- Visual Studio:微软公司开发的集成开发环境,支持ASP代码的调试。

- IIS(Internet Information Services):微软公司提供的Web服务器,支持ASP应用程序的运行和调试。

- 浏览器开发者工具:如Chrome DevTools、Firefox Developer Tools等,用于检查网页元素和调试JavaScript代码。

二、ASP代码调试的高效技巧

1. 使用断点

断点是调试过程中的一种重要工具,可以帮助开发者快速定位代码执行的位置。

- 设置断点:在Visual Studio中,可以通过点击代码左侧的空白区域来设置断点。

- 条件断点:设置条件断点可以使代码在满足特定条件时才停止执行。

- 断点分组:将断点分组可以方便地管理多个断点。

2. 单步执行

单步执行是调试过程中的基本操作,可以帮助开发者逐步分析代码执行过程。

- 逐行执行:逐行执行可以使代码一行一行地执行,便于观察变量值的变化。

- 逐过程执行:逐过程执行可以使代码在调用其他过程时停止执行,便于分析过程间的交互。

3. 观察变量

观察变量是调试过程中的关键步骤,可以帮助开发者了解代码执行过程中的变量值。

- 快速查看变量:在Visual Studio中,可以通过在代码中右键点击变量名,选择“快速查看”来查看变量的值。

- 监视窗口:监视窗口可以显示多个变量的值,便于观察变量值的变化。

4. 使用日志记录

日志记录是一种有效的调试方法,可以帮助开发者了解程序运行过程中的关键信息。

- 添加日志语句:在代码中添加日志语句可以记录程序运行过程中的关键信息。

- 分析日志文件:通过分析日志文件,可以了解程序运行过程中的异常情况。

5. 利用浏览器开发者工具

浏览器开发者工具可以帮助开发者检查网页元素和调试JavaScript代码,从而提高调试效率。

- 检查HTML和CSS:通过检查HTML和CSS,可以了解网页布局和样式问题。

- 调试JavaScript:通过调试JavaScript,可以了解JavaScript代码的执行过程。

6. 编写单元测试

单元测试是一种自动化测试方法,可以帮助开发者验证代码的正确性。

- 编写测试用例:编写测试用例可以验证代码的功能。

- 运行测试用例:运行测试用例可以快速发现代码中的错误。

三、总结

ASP代码调试是开发过程中不可或缺的环节,掌握高效的调试技巧可以提高开发效率,提升代码质量。本文介绍了ASP代码调试的基本概念和高效技巧,包括使用断点、单步执行、观察变量、使用日志记录、利用浏览器开发者工具和编写单元测试等。希望这些技巧能够帮助开发者更好地进行ASP代码调试。

四、拓展阅读

- 《ASP.NET编程精解》

- 《Visual Studio调试技巧》

- 《JavaScript高级程序设计》

通过学习这些资料,可以进一步丰富自己的ASP代码调试技能。